Kenneth B. Beljanski

Attorney

Kenneth is an attorney at Brown & Crouppen, focusing his practice on workers’ compensation cases. He brings more than 20 years of experience in personal injury law, practicing in firms throughout Illinois.

Kenneth is licensed to practice in Illinois and admitted to practice in the Federal Court for the Southern District of Illinois and the Federal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it. He received his law degree from Southern Illinois University School of Law, where he was an ATLA Trial Competition National Finalist and a member of the Southern Illinois Inn of Court. Kenneth earned both his bachelor’s degree and master’s degree from Southern Illinois University Edwardsville, where he was a member of the Phi Alpha Delta Pre-Law Society. He served as both president and vice president of Sigma Phi Epsilon during his undergraduate years, and as an advisor during his graduate years.
